Comprehending Misted Double Glazing


Misted double glazing takes place when condensation kinds between the two panes of glass. This can lead to an unsightly foggy look and indicate prospective failure of the window seal. When the seal is jeopardized, moisture gets in the area in between the panes, resulting in condensation.

Reasons For Misted Double Glazing

Numerous elements can add to the incident of misted double glazing:

Cause

Description

Poor Installation

Improperly sealed units during installation can lead to premature seal failure.

Age of Windows

Older double glazing units are more prone to seal destruction in time.

Temperature level Changes

Rapid fluctuations in temperature level can worry the seal, leading to its eventual failure.

Production Defects

Faulty products or building can trigger powerlessness in the insulation in between the panes.

Ecological Factors

High humidity levels in certain climates can cause increased moisture and tension on seals.

Solutions for Misted Double Glazing


When confronted with misted double glazing, house owners have numerous alternatives to think about. While some solutions may fix the issue temporarily, others can provide a more permanent fix.

1. Repair Options

Repair Method

Description

Seal Repair

Involves resealing the edges of the window system to avoid additional moisture ingress.

Desiccant Installation

A desiccant is placed into the space to take in trapped moisture, reducing the fogging.

Glass Unit Replacement

Changing just the affected glass unit rather than the entire window frame.

2. Replacement Options

Replacement Strategy

Description

Full Window Replacement

Changing the entire window for a new beginning and enhanced energy efficiency.

Double-Glazed Unit Replacement

Changing simply the double-glazed unit, keeping the existing frame to save costs.

Updated Glass Technology

Choosing modern glass technologies that are less susceptible to misting and fogging issues.
